Nice pub done out like a British pub with wooden paneling and looks and feels like you’re in a uk pub. Good selection of beers and was busy with mixture of Spanish and British customers . We had Sunday roast which was cheap and in my opinion, not very good. Lots of people like it though, it just wasn’t for me. No butter in the mash or given for the bread with soup, one roast potato which hadn’t even got any colour because wasn’t roasted long enough, aunt Bessie Yorkshire pudding which was flexible not crispy, gravy which was very thick just not very good and beef was overcooked. The veg selection was good and was fresh so not all bad. The soup starter was very small but the meals cheap so can’t complain too much. I’d not recommend the Sunday roast based on what I had and although I ate it all, it wasn’t very good and if you want a good roast look at my other reviews as found a fantastic place not too far to drive. Another pet hate was staff smoking while clearing on the terrace where people were eating. This was really disgusting in my opinion. I’d return to just drink and would avoid the food based on my experience.

They do amazing fish and chips. Normally they charge €7.95 which is a good price, but on a Wednesday they do a special price for only €5.95. Nice large piece of fish with moist flaky fish. Not the often dry rubbish sold elsewhere. Puts ALL of Ireland to shame as they have no clue how to make fish and chips anywhere there. I got mine take away, but there were loads of people sitting inside and all of them were eating fish and chips.
